Assistant to the On-Site Director at the Pushkin Summer Institute
The Pushkin Summer Institute (PSI) is an intensive pre-college summer program aimed at high-school students from underrepresented communities. Our unique, five-week program combines the intensive study of Russian language, culture, and civilization with residential living …
